## Further Reading

The session-token refresh bug in Quillgate's auth layer has bitten every contractor at least once. Short version: tokens refreshed within 30 seconds of expiry can race and invalidate the session entirely. The fix shipped in v4.2 but legacy Quillgate clients still trigger it. Don't debug this from scratch. Marla's writeup covers the race condition, the retry workaround, and which client versions are affected. The full postmortem and mitigation notes live on the internal wiki page here.

operations page: https://jenkins.zemvarcloud.local/job/merge_requests/repo/build/73930b4b30f0a8ed

Release checklist — Wrenfeld Search 3.8: Confirm the autocomplete index rebuild completes under 20 minutes on the staging replica. Last cycle it ran 4+ hours because the trigram shards weren't warmed before reindexing; ops added a pre-warm step to the deploy script. Sign-off requires p95 suggestion latency under 80ms on the staging dashboard for one full hour. Record your verification against the candidate build noted below.

pipeline stamp: htk9_ce63042d9

## v2.4.0 — SquatHawk scanner

Welcome, new folks! This release adds fuzzy-matching against the Brindle registry's top packages, so SquatHawk now catches swapped-letter and homoglyph squats, not just prefix clones. False positives dropped a lot after we added the maintainer-history check. Scans run nightly; results land in the quarantine queue. If something looks misclassified, don't delete it from quarantine yourself — escalate instead. For questions about this release or the scanner roadmap, contact the maintainer listed below.

signatory, fahof-bagag: Wenath Novys

## Deep-Link Routing: Limits and Quotas

The Foxglass deep-link router resolves inbound links against a cached route manifest. To protect the resolver during campaign spikes, per-app lookup rates and manifest refresh intervals are capped. Maintainers should not raise these caps without load-testing the fallback path first. The enforced constants appear below.

constants for yajof-hadup:
RATE_LIMITS = {
    "druael": 2,
    "ralael": 10,
}